2022年算命源码,风水 源码
最后更新 :2021.11.23 15:07
2022年算命源码

受访者 | 邵宗文,腾讯云图数据库产品经理
记者| 夕颜
出品 | CSDN(ID:CSDNnews)
AI 技术生态论」 人物访谈栏目是 CSDN 发起的百万人学 AI 倡议下的重要组成部分。通过对 AI 生态顶级大咖、创业者、行业 KOL 的访谈,反映其对于行业的思考、未来趋势判断、技术实践,以及成长经历。
本文为 「AI 技术生态论」系列访谈第三十四期。
百万人学 AI 你也有份!今日起, 阅读 报名「2022 AI开发者万人大会」,使用优惠码“AIP211”,即可免费获得价值299元的大会在线直播门票一张。100张,先到先得。
近日,又一国产数据库诞生!这次是腾讯家推出的分布式图数据库产品——腾讯云数图 TGDB(Tencent Graph Database)。
据称,这款数据库能够实现万亿级关联关系数据实时查询,高效处理异构数据,支持实时图计算。从理论上说,该图数据库的集群节点规模可以达到万台以上,在不同的公开数据集下查询速度比世界市场占有率更高的 Neo4j 快 20-150 倍!
在近年,图数据库逐渐火爆起来,据 Gartner 在《十大数据分析技术趋势》预测,2012 年至 2022 年,全球图处理及图数据库的应用都将以每年 100% 的速度迅猛增长,DB Engines 近 7 年数据库流行趋势也显示,图数据库相较其他主流数据库受欢迎程度遥遥领先。
此前,业内主流图数据库产品主要为国外厂商,国内金融、电商、能源等重点行业只能依赖于国外图数据库产品。在此背景下, 我们什么时候能拥有真正能满足国内企业需求的强大国产数据库,成为大家关心的热门话题。好在随着大数据,尤其是图数据的重要性被更多厂商意识到之后,国内大小厂也相继推出了自己的图数据库产品,试图打破国外技术厂商的垄断,包括大厂阿里云的图数据库 GDB,蚂蚁金服自主研发的分布式图数据库 GeaBase,华为的 GraphBase,小企业如杭州欧若数 科技也有自己的图数据产品 Nebula Graph,维加星信息科技的TigerGraph 等。
按照理论,从技术适配性、安全性、成本上来说,国产数据库产品应该更加符合国内企业的需求和信息化的节奏。事实上是这样吗?我们今天的 重点,是与已经发布的图数据库产品和国外数据库产品相比,腾讯云数图新发布的这个 TGDB 有哪些特别之处?是否比它们更有优势?为此,CSDN 邀请到腾讯云图数据库产品经理邵宗文,来从研发背景到上层设计,全面评估一下这个图数据库产品是否名符其实。

TGDB 的研发背景
在 5G、物联 、人工智能等数字化技术的推动下,企业数据呈爆发式增长,数据间的关联复杂度也随之剧增。传统关系型数据库在处理复杂关联数据时运算效率较低,且难以帮助企业进一步挖掘海量关系数据背后的价值。为了更好地利用数据间的连接,企业需要一种将关系存储为实体、灵活拓展数据模型的数据库技术,腾讯看到了图数据库潜藏的机会。
在深入调研后,腾讯发现客户其实往往需要的是一辆车,除了制造图数据库发动机之外还需要一系列合作伙伴来做配套,才能满足企业的需要。目前,腾讯的图数据库生态构成主要都是行业顶尖数据库人才和及相关上下游合作伙伴,其中有海归,和 10 多年数据库领域的资深专家构成,重点研究方向包括图数据库分布式存储、高性能计算、图算法,以及生态组件如迁移工具、可视化、数据抽取、数据建模等。

图数据库技术上的突破
相比于国内外其他图数据库产品,TGDB 有一些独特的特性。总的来说,正是因为 TGDB 在技术上的一些突破带来了性能上的提升和架构上的灵活扩展,才实现了全新的特性,包括去中心化纯分布式架构、高效的原生存储、图切割和分布式算法等。
去中心化分布式系统架构
据邵宗文介绍,TGDB 采用了去中心化分布式架构,理论上支持线性扩展,从目前的部署和使用来看,TGDB 的图数据存储极限还远没有到达极限,在实验室中,团队曾在测试中测得图数据集群节点数量为 100 台,但根据理论推演,TGDB 图数据库的集群节点规模可以达到万台以上,在不同的公开数据集下查询速度比世界市场占有率更高的 Neo4j 还要快 20-150 倍。
如此大规模的存储极限和极快的查询速度,与 TGDB 的系统架构设计分不开。

TGDB 分布式图数据库从内部架构上主要分 3 层:
资源管理层:负责对底层计算与数据资源进行管理和调配,简单地说,就是负责协调把每个计算任务和对应的数据按照某种算法分发到各个分布式节点上执行、监控、容错并汇总结果;
数据抽象层:提供了属性图(Property Graph)的抽象,涉及到图的数据结构、存储、访问模式和消息协议;
上层算法应用层:提供了基于分布式计算引擎的算法,这些算法需要访问数据抽象层的图数据,按照每个算法不同设计,把算法的执行变为可以分布式并行处理的单元,交给资源管理层执行。
TGDB 图数据库系统在集群部署的架构是完全分布式去中心化的,各个节点都很平权,不存在单 master 的单点故障或为了防止该问题而导致的系统复杂度。
底层数据一致性基于一套稳定的消息队列和快照机制,使得任何节点和过程都可以假设一个虚拟的稳定的中间信息交互平台,并且平台保证消息的全局一致性、排序、更高一次送达等保证,同时支持多份热备,结合合理的机柜布局,可以保证高容错能力。
从技术层面上来讲,TGDB 是如何才能实现万亿级关联关系数据实时查询?对此,邵宗了详细的解释。
他说到,大规模的实时查询不是一个简单的查询分流或者优化就可以解决的,需要查询计划优化、高并发任务处理机制、分布式底层资源管理与系统部署架构的紧密配合才能高效实现。
具体来说,TGDB 首先把每个查询或计算请求变成一个优化的 DAG(Directed Acyclic Graph),分布式任务通过 DAG 模型保证前置依赖正确完成,每个 DAG 的顶点是一个可执行任务,边是一个逻辑先后关系或数据传输任务,各个机器节点并行调度分解任务,每个 DAG 被分解成了多个没有相互依赖的独立计算任务,这类计算任务变的非常容易被并行的分发与执行,因为任务之间没有了依赖关系以及消息发送/接受/处理等问题,大大降低了系统任务控制复杂度,实现了高并发计算工作流优化控制。
TGDB 分布式资源管理逻辑负责统一管理和调度集群的计算资源和数据存储资源,任何分布式机器节点上都可以进行任务注册和发布,支持跨多平台移植,功能上提供任务的监控、转移和恢复。分布式资源管理使用了 bag of tasks 模式,在平台内构建了资源池,使得其中的计算任务可以被各个节点智能获取执行,高效发挥去中心化自组织架构的优势,实现更优化、无瓶颈、高容错的调度分布式资源。
简单地说,基于这样的设计,高并发的实时查询可以被系统分拆成易于分布式并行执行的单元,被整个系统优化执行。
原生图存储
从存储计算方式上来说,TGDB 使用了原生图存储,不依赖于任何 数据存储平台,如 HBase 或 RocksDB 等,存储系统是腾讯自主研发,这一点和国外的 Neo4j 等原生图类似,而不同于开源的 JanusGraph 等产品。
相比之下,原生图在查询和运算速度上比非原生图有巨大的性能优势。为了说明这一点,邵宗文打了个比方:原生图上层和存储通讯相当于一个人自己与自己在脑中对话,非原生图上层和 存储通讯相当于人和人之间用语言来沟通,需要喊一声,对方听到,再回复。可以看到,非原生模式下,性能代价更高,尤其是在进行深度图查询、多轮迭代计算、图的数据量变时,劣势会更加明显。
图切割算法
传统的图算法大多是基于矩阵来进行表达和运算的,而 TGDB 的另一个技术特点是分布式,不仅是系统架构和部署上的分布式,更重要的是分布式的图分割算法和其他分布式图算法的设计和实现。是否支持图分割也是一个图数据库是否能真正支持线性扩展的关键,这一点与一些其他数据库产品有本质区别。TGDB真正实现了把一张大图分割成一片一片的小图,分散到各个分布式节点存储,而不是用 Raft 协议等搭建一个单节点,全图没有图切割、分布式节点上每一个节点都是全图的存储方式。显然,后者本质上还是要把所有数据在一台单机上存储,无法真正支持数据量的延展。TGDB 是原生的分布式图数据库,数据存储抽象就是顶点和边,不是矩阵的形式,同时进行了图分割,把一张大图分成了很多片存放在了多台服务器上。在这种新的结构下,传统的图算法需要彻底重写,变成用顶点和边的形式、充分考虑图数据分片的分布、极致优化跨服务器消息传输的方式,以实现可扩展的分布式并发执行。
其他特性
查询语言支持 Neo4j 的 Cypher 语言
在查询语言方面,TGDB 支持 Neo4j 的 Cypher 语言,可以和 Neo4j 进行简单替换,也支持易用的图形用户界面,让分析人员不用编程就可以快速进行图管理和图迭代分析。
TGDB 具有高扩展、高集成、运算快、轻部署等特点,核心功能如下表:

与 AI 前沿技术相结合
TGDB 目前支持多种算法并在不断增加,同时,它可以和腾讯的柏拉图计算引擎平台结合,输出算法能力,包括一些图神经 络的算法。另外,邵宗文提到,如前所述,传统图算法在分布式架构下需要被重构优化,TGDB 在这方面还有很多科研任务要完成,这也是学术上的一个前沿领域。

图数据库展望:首先在金融领域有爆发式增长
作为图数据库领域专家,邵宗文从技术创新和应用两方面对图数据库未来的发展趋势做了一个预测。
他预计,图数据库预计会首先在金融领域有爆发式增长,因为之前传统的关系型数据库或大数据其实受限于先天架构问题,比如传统数据库无法很好解决金融风控相关问题,以及员工和亲属、员工与客户、客户之间的关系、业务合规的关系,这些都是非常复杂的关系。
另外,随着 5G 时代的到来,人与人、人与物、物与物的联结信息会越来越多,这也为图数据库提供了很好的发展机会。

TGDB 未来规划:到传统行业大展拳脚
当前,TGDB 的应用场景包括互联 、金融风控、物联 、电力 络、电子商务、智慧交通、生物序列研究、医疗诊断决策、疾病传播分析、辅助司法决策、公共安全等。但在未来,邵宗文表示,TGDB 还将深挖传统行业,如能源、电力行业数据之间的关联。他说道,这些行业虽然已经具备了一定的数据整合能力,但数据之间关联关系的挖掘其实还比较困难,以电力知识图谱为例,支持对电 中接入的各类时序量测数据进行存储和更新,并直接对电 中电力设备的从属关系和拓扑结构进行表示,全面揭示设备状态和设备之间的关系,实现全 设备的监控与管理。不同于传统的基于向量和矩阵进行大型运算的耗时操作,由于复杂的电力 络及知识以图结构进行了表示,可以直接在图上进行查询和计算,并将计算结果直接作为图中的元素进行存储,大幅提升电 计算和分析效率,实现电 运行方式检索、设备状态推理、设备画像和家族性缺陷分析等应用。
而这些,都是 TGDB 未来可以大展拳脚的领域。

刘强东卖光碟,周鸿祎“电脑算命”,马云卖鲜花,盘点 IT 大佬摆过的地摊
从地摊看云计算:规模产业历程大揭秘
和“大打出手”时,微信搜索去哪儿了?
怒肝 8 个月源码,我成为了 Spring 开源贡献者
干货 | 基于SRS直播平台的监控系统之实现思路与过程
挖矿仍然有利可图吗?
以上就是与2022年算命源码相关内容,是关于图算法的分享。看完风水 源码后,希望这对大家有所帮助!
周的成语有哪些成语大全
在中国的成语宝库中,以“周”字开头的成语数量不少,它们形态各异,含义丰富,展现出独特的文化魅力。这些成语犹如一颗颗璀璨的明珠,在历史的长河中闪烁着智慧的光芒。“...
灶口不宜朝哪个方向 厨房灶台最旺三个方向
灶口不宜朝哪个方向:厨房风水的重要考量在传统的家居风水学中,灶口的朝向是一个不容忽视的因素,它被认为会对家庭的运势、健康、财运等诸多方面产生影响。了解灶口不宜朝哪个方向,有助于我们打造一个和谐、吉祥的家居环境...
迟为什么是18划 迟笔画一共几笔
标题:《探究“迟”字为何是18划》在汉字的世界里,每一个字都有着独特的结构和笔画数量,这些要素不仅构成了汉字的外在形态,也蕴含着丰富的历史文化内涵。今天,我们将深入探讨“迟”字为何是18划这一有趣的话题。一、康熙字...
路姓如何起名 路姓怎么起名
崔姓起名:匠心独运,寓意深远在中华姓氏的海洋中,崔姓以其悠久的历史和深厚的文化底蕴,成为了...
属猴的人今天运气如何 属猴的运势今天的运势
根据提供的搜索结果, 无法直接给出属猴人2024年6月17日的运势,因为搜索结果中并没有包含 这一天的具体运势信息。 如果您需要了解属猴人2024年6月17日的详细运势,建议访问专门提供生肖每日运势的网站或应用程序,以 获取最...
为什么世间情感 世上的感情为什么这样苦
关于您的问题“为什么世间情感”,我从搜索结果中找到了一些相关的解释和观点。首先,情感是人类社会的重要组成部分,它连接了人与人之间的关系,赋予了生活丰富的色彩。无论是爱情、亲情还是友情,都是人类情感的重要表现形式...
大庆哪里取名好(大庆哪里取名好听点)
大庆哪里取名好:探索大庆的命名文化与优质命名场所 在人生的各个阶段,无论是新生儿取名、公司命名还是品牌命名,一个好的名字都至关重要。在大庆这座充满活力的城市,如何找到一处优质、富有文化底蕴的命名场所呢?本文将为...
家里养哪些花最“镇宅”?这4种花很霸气,家里至少养一盆
在我们的日常生活中,家中摆放一些花卉不仅能为居室增添美感,还能给家人带来好运。而有些花...
8月搬家风水禁忌,你搬对了吗?
很多人觉得搬家是小事,但在搬家过程中有很多需要注意的地方,很可能一个小小的举动就影响了...
哪个星座性格独断(哪个星座的人性格最好)
在星座学中,每个星座都有其独特的性格特点。但是,有些星座的个性表现得尤为明显,在其中,最为...
天平座与哪个星座相似(天平座女生和哪个星座般配)
天平座是黄道带上的第七个星座,因其标志性的双盘天秤而得名。人们认为天平座的人具有追求...
沛和哪个字组名字(jia字哪个当名字好)
沛和,一个具有传统文化底蕴和现代风格的名字,在中国文化中有着丰富的含义。沛和两个字的组...
如何安坟(今年如何上新坟) 安坟有哪些讲究?
如何安葬逝者是一件需要花费精力和时间的事情。尤其对于亲友的离去,我们更希望能够为他们...
1988年龙的命运如何(1988年龙运势走向)
1988年是中国农历的龙年,对于那些以龙命名的人来说,这一年无疑是非常特殊和重要的。那么,19...
手机qq群怎么起名字(qq群怎样起名字)
在现代社会中,手机成为了我们经常使用的一种工具,而很多人在手机上使用QQ软件来与他人进行...
爸爸姓邱怎么取名(爸爸姓王怎么取名)
父亲是家庭中的重要角色,他们为孩子们提供安全、稳定和鼓励的环境,让孩子们茁壮成长。爸爸...
属相鸡今日运势 属相鸡今日运势每日运程
大家好,今天来为大家分享属相鸡今日运势的一些知识点,和属鸡今日运势每日更新的问题解析,大...
测字算命怎么算婚姻 测字算命怎么算的出来
大家好,测字算命怎么算婚姻相信很多的网友都不是很明白,包括测字看婚姻准不准也是一样,不过...
五六什么星座 五六七是什么星座
本篇文章给大家谈谈五六什么星座,以及5一6是什么星座对应的知识点,文章可能有点长,但是希望...
十二星座壁纸夏天 十二星座壁纸 手机壁纸
大家好,今天来为大家解答十二星座壁纸夏天这个问题的一些问题点,包括12星座壁纸也一样很多...
风水曰厉挂在家里哪个位置
本篇文章给大家谈谈风水曰厉挂在家里哪个位置,以及风水日历挂在家里什么地方好对应的知识...
周易八卦卦象图解大全 周易八卦图解详解
大家好,如果您还对周易八卦卦象图解大全不太了解,没有关系,今天就由本站为大家分享周易八卦...
周易八卦六爻解说详解 周易6爻卦图解详解
大家好,关于周易八卦六爻解说详解很多朋友都还不太明白,不过没关系,因为今天小编就来为大家...
朝西房间里的风水好不好 房间朝西好吗
大家好,今天来为大家解答朝西房间里的风水好不好这个问题的一些问题点,包括卧室门朝西的房...
北大八字算命教授是谁 北大命理学
其实北大八字算命教授是谁的问题并不复杂,但是又很多的朋友都不太了解八字预测清华大学教...
明天属羊的运势 明天属羊的运势12月24日运势
本篇文章给大家谈谈明天属羊的运势,以及明天属羊人的运势对应的知识点,文章可能有点长,但是...
白羊男喜欢一个人的表现超准,白羊座的男生喜欢一个人的时候,会有哪些表现
提起白羊男喜欢一个人的表现超准,大家都知道,有人问白羊座的男生喜欢一个人的时候,会有哪些...
学无止境,八字成语,学生励志八字成语大全
提起学无止境,八字成语,大家都知道,有人问学生励志八字成语大全,另外,还有人想问形容学无止...
鼻子大的女人表示很有钱吗(鼻子越大越有钱吗)
相学中我们都知道鼻子是财帛宫,民间有这么一种说法:说鼻子大的女生会很有财运。那么这种说...
千万不要随便去算塔罗牌 塔罗牌占卜真的可信吗
塔罗牌是的“八卦算命”,不过相比于后者以算法为准,塔罗更像是与神秘学的结合。再加上塔罗...
2022年化解太岁最简单的方法 犯太岁最灵验化解方法
在2022年,有部分生肖因为犯太岁的原因,从而出现运势不好的情况,这些生肖就特别想要了解2022...
金木水火土年份对照表,出生年份与五行对照表
提起金木水火土年份对照表,大家都知道,有人问出生年份与五行对照表,另外,还有人想问五行对应...
80年属猴人2022年运势如何,1976年属龙人2022年运势运程
80年属猴人2022年运势如何 1980年出生的属猴人在2022年运势不好,这一年对于他们来说不仅...
2022年马年运程与运势,属马人在2022年的运势如何
2022年马年运程与运势 知运改命,理解本人所在生肖或星座的运势,能够顺势翻身。属蛇天...
出生年月看五行金木水火土,金木水火土五行对应生辰
出生年月看五行金木水火土 所谓五行指的就是金木水火土,在命理学中,人们的命理也有五行之...
属虎的今年运势2022每月,2022 年十二生肖每月运势详解
属虎的今年运势2022每月 生肖虎人常常是霸气十足,给人一种强势的觉得。但这种人常常...
属龙与属鸡的合不合,属龙属鸡的互为贵人吗
属龙与属鸡的合不合 属龙和属鸡的人在一起的话其实都是会在相配度上都是很高的,因为他们...
男虎女兔婚配好不好,男属虎女属兔结合好不好
男虎女兔婚配好不好 胡适与这名女子有两个理由不宜婚配,为何仍然得以厮守终生? 胡适是民...
- 数据加载中,请稍后...